Homeowners insurance and home warranties are two sides of the same coin. Insurance covers catastrophic events. A warranty covers gradual wear and tear. If you are a homeowner near International Bank of Commerce in Laredo, Texas, having both means you are fully protected.

Coverage limits are clearly defined in your contract, so you always know what to expect. The warranty provider will cover repairs up to the specified limit, and you are responsible for any costs above that amount.

Home warranty coverage is designed to handle the most common and expensive home repairs. The average cost of an HVAC replacement is $5,000 to $10,000, while a water heater replacement can cost $1,000 to $3,000. With a home warranty, you pay only a small service fee.

The service call fee is typically the only out-of-pocket cost for a covered repair. This fee ranges from $75 to $125, depending on your plan and location.
